Hi Corvell Integrations team,

Thanks for agreeing to review the FillRoute planner endpoints before Friday's cutover. Please exercise the route-optimization and slot-forecast calls against our staging environment only; production data is out of scope for this pass. Rate limits are relaxed on staging, but please keep batch sizes under 500 machines per request so logs stay readable. All endpoints require an Authorization header; for this review cycle, please use the staging bearer token included below.

portal login ticket: eyJhbGciOiJIUzI1NiIsInR5cCI6IkpXVCJ9.eyJzdWIiOiIwEOsktwVNwIn0.-UJU3fdyyCgG

Action item: The Relayn deploy-status bot silently dropped updates when the pipeline API paginated results, so responders believed a rollback had completed when it had not. We will add pagination handling, a staleness banner, and an integration test. Until merged, verify deploy state directly in the pipeline console, documented at the page below.

runbook for kahop-kajop: https://rundeck.ordinio.test/display/secrets/pipeline/issue/pages/repo/browse/e5732776e07d1285107e5aeb

Hey Rask — handing over before my shift ends. The paper ledgers from the old Brindlehart office are boxed and labelled by year; they go to the Corvane archive annex, not the shredding bay, so keep them off pallet row C. Inventory slips are taped to each lid. The courier arrangement for tomorrow is noted below.

courier memo of yawep-yafog: the pramir ulaix courier leaves the ulavan aldix frair zorok oliiel joreth rusdor fenvan ledger at gate 1305 under passcode 514738

Subject: Cut-over done — dependency pinning on Ferngate

Welcome aboard. Quick summary: Ferngate now enforces exact-version pinning across all build manifests. Floating ranges are rejected at CI. Upgrades go through the weekly pin-bump job, not manual edits. If a build breaks on a pin conflict, file it against the platform queue, don't override locally. The enforcement settings now active in CI are below.

deployment values, kajep-kageg:
[praix]
host = praix.paliqcorp.corp
user = praix_svc
database = praix_prod